North East booklet gives advice on international business etiquette |

Knowing cultural differences can be the key for a successful business outcome. Williams Language Solutions has developed a guide about dos and don’ts when travelling abroad or meeting foreign guests.
Williams Language Solutions – the North East England Company specialised in international communication, translations and localisation of websites – has developed a guide about dos and don’ts when travelling abroad. Stefania Williams of Williams Language Solutions, says: "How to speak Culturese - 56 pages in black and white with colour cover page - includes information on business manners and guides to customs and etiquette in 10 countries worldwide. Each guide was prepared by an expert consultant with the specific goal of raising awareness about cultural diversities, and helping you to speak the language of the mind. We took a well-known recipe and added some zest, a bit of a “kick”, to help you find it more enticing, and retain the information much more easily." She continues: "All contributors are passionate about their culture, and they are proud to present it to others, representing it to the world. You will not just find a list of advice: through the text, you will see the people; you will be able to visualise their culture through our words, because they were written out of our passion. We have been working on this booklet for months and months, searching for the right ambassadors for each of the countries. The illustrations by Fern Wood help to explode stereotypes while offering something very typical of each country. "To do or not to do? Si fa o non si fa? Macht man das oder macht man das nicht? This is the question we try to answer as our travels take us through France, Hungary, Italy, Japan, Germany, the Netherlands, Poland, Russia, Tunisia and the USA as we turn the pages of this booklet", concludes Stefania. Learning the customs and culture of a foreign country signals communication competence and shows a great respect for others. It is vital when travelling abroad, and also at home, when meeting guests and business contacts from abroad. The booklet is now for sale on paperback or downloadablem ideal for intranet sites.
